worked with a youngster with LD the other day and I really wanted a
portable writing solution that had built-in text-to-speech (TTS).
Years ago I had acquired an A----Smart and used it infrequently over
the years. But TTS on it was poor, and every time the unit lost
its charge I would have to go through the *painful* process of
re-installing an 'applet' and TTS, and it also required an external
voice card that plugged in the rear that sounded, well, not good.
I met up with a rep. for Writer Learning while at a conference in Utah
and he showed me their new Fusion. It 'fixed' everything I
thought was wrong with the A-Smart and added a bunch of features that I
loved!
You can hear the Fusion's TTS through
included headphones or its great built-in speaker!
This unit also works great as a simple AAC device! Other
text-based TTS products of this nature cost several thousand dollars!
I've even worked with the manufacturer to modify the software a bit so
it's useful for blind persons and note-taking!
